What to Consider When Choosing a Robot Vacuum:

Choosing the right robot vacuum includes more than just choosing the flashiest model. Thoroughly think about the following aspects to ensure you choose a device that genuinely meets your requirements and supplies worth:
Budget: Robot vacuums range in cost from under ₤ 200 to over ₤ 1000. Determine your spending plan upfront to limit your alternatives. Bear in mind that greater cost points frequently correlate with advanced features like smarter navigation, stronger suction, and self-emptying abilities.Floor Types: Consider the dominant floor enters your home. Homes with mainly tough floorings might gain from designs with mopping functions, while homes with thick carpets require strong suction power and brush roll styles crafted for carpet cleaning. Some models are flexible and perform well on both hard floors and carpets.Pet Ownership: Pet hair is a typical cleaning difficulty. If you have pets, search for robot vacuums particularly designed to take on pet hair. These often feature tangle-free brush rolls, robust suction, and efficient filtering systems to capture irritants.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or those with numerous levels may require robot vacuums with longer battery life and smart mapping functions to make sure total cleaning protection. Residences with complex designs and many obstacles will benefit from advanced navigation systems.Smart Features and Connectivity: Do you desire app control, scheduling, virtual walls, or voice assistant integration? Smart features boost convenience and customisation however typically come at a higher cost.Navigation and Mapping:Random Bounce: Basic models typically use random bounce navigation, which is less efficient however can still clean efficiently in smaller sized areas.Systematic Navigation (LiDAR or Camera-based): More sophisticated designs use L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or camera-based systems to map your home and browse systematically. This causes more efficient cleaning, room-by-room cleaning, and the ability to set virtual borders.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), suction power figures out how effectively a robot vacuum gets dirt and particles. Greater suction is generally much better, specifically for carpets and pet hair.Battery Life and Charging: Battery life determines the length of time the robot vacuum can work on a single charge. Think about the size of your home and select a model with adequate battery life to clean it successfully. Automatic recharging is a standard function, where the robot go back to its dock when the battery is low.Self-Emptying Feature: Some premium models feature self cleaning robot vacuum-emptying bases. These bases instantly suck the dust and particles from the robot's dustbin into a bigger, non reusable bag, significantly reducing the frequency of manual dustbin emptying and boosting convenience.Sound Level: Robot vacuums vary in sound output. If sound level of sensitivity is an issue, look for designs marketed as quiet operating.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s):
Q: Are robot vacuums worth the financial investment?A: For busy people and those looking for to decrease their cleaning workload, robot vacuums can be a worthwhile investment. They automate a tedious task and can keep a regularly cleaner home.Q: Can robot vacuums change traditional vacuums completely?A: Robot vacuums are excellent for routine upkeep cleaning however may not completely replace traditional vacuums for deep cleaning jobs, corner cleaning, or cleaning upholstery and stairs. Lots of users discover they supplement their robot hoover uk vacuum with a conventional vacuum for more intensive cleaning.Q: How often should I run my robot vacuum?A: Daily cleaning is ideal for keeping a consistently clean home, especially in households with family pets or children. However, you can change the frequency based upon your needs and family traffic.Q: Do robot vacuums deal with carpets and rugs?A: Yes, many robot vacuums are created to work on both hard floors and carpets. Try to find models with strong suction and brush rolls created for carpet cleaning efficiency.Q: How long do robot vacuums generally last?A: With proper upkeep, a great quality robot vacuum can last for numerous years, normally 3-5 years or longer depending upon usage and brand.Q: Are robot vacuums loud?A: Robot vacuums typically produce less sound than standard vacuums, however sound levels differ in between designs. Some designs are particularly designed for quieter operation.Q: What is the difference between LiDAR and camera-based navigation?A: L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) utilizes lasers to produce a detailed map of your home, providing accurate navigation and efficient cleaning courses. Camera-based systems utilize visual details to browse. LiDAR is generally considered more accurate and efficient in low-light conditions.
